Transaction ec6a01d5233839929ddda0dd47c2a9aa06ccbe9aaf00e6949fe169bada70d69e
1 Input
1 Output
-
ec6a01d5233839929ddda0dd47c2a9aa06ccbe9aaf00e6949fe169bada70d69e:0
- value
- 2724116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fdca930c60df1a65be07c7fc5b725ec2f59ea93 OP_EQUAL
- address
- 3DM65hE6uDWLEbm5jKWBCQ9qzN9F5c9QbJ